Fairly Trained launches certification for generative AI models that respect creators’ rights. I've been using the term "vegan models" for a while to describe machine learning models that have been trained in a way that avoids using unlicensed, copyrighted data. Fairly Trained is a new non-profit initiative that aims to encourage such models through a "certification" stamp of approval.
The team is lead by Ed Newton-Rex, who was previously VP of Audio at Stability AI before leaving over ethical concerns with the way models were being trained.
